Does jumping rope work calves?
Jumping rope hits some muscles that far too many strength workouts forget: the calves, Fisniku says. This is the primary muscle group that jumping rope works. Comprising both the gastrocnemius and the soleus muscles, the calves are in charge of extending your ankles with each jump.
What is the best calf exercise?
Running, walking, and hiking are excellent calf-strengthening exercises, especially when you go uphill. The steeper the climb, the more your calves have to work. Running sports such as soccer, basketball, and tennis demand that you run, jump, and push off your calf muscles to accelerate or change direction quickly.

How many times a week should you jump rope?
When you are doing an aerobic exercise like jump rope, you should prefer time over the number of repetitions. A minimum of 150 minutes of medium intensity or 75 minutes of higher intensity skipping should be done each week, according to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ention.
